Abstract

The invention discloses a preparation method of short fiber reinforced silicon carbide ceramics containing silicon dioxide. The preparation method is characterized in that the short fiber reinforced silicon carbide ceramics are prepared from the following raw materials in parts by weight: 60-80 parts of silicon carbide, 10-15 parts of a chopped carbon fiber predispersion body, 3-4 parts of a sintering additive, 8-12 parts of a silicon dioxide grinding material, 2-3 parts of iridium trioxide, 4-6 parts of albite powder, 4-6 parts of mullite powder, 20-25 parts of absolute ethyl alcohol, 2-3 parts of polypropylene glycol and 70-80 parts of deionized water. According to the preparation method disclosed by the invention, chopped carbon fibers are added, so that the mechanical performance of silicon carbide can be improved, the fracture toughness of the ceramics can be improved, the strength and compactness of biscuits can be improved, and the mechanical processing requirements can be met; silicon dioxide is added, so that the effects of enhancing the thermal stability, strength, corrosion resistance and thermal conductivity of the silicon carbide ceramics can be achieved; and the preparation method is convenient in raw material source, convenient to operate, low in cost and good in application prospect.

Description

A kind of preparation method of the short fiber reinforced silicon carbide ceramics containing silicon-dioxide
Technical field
the present invention relates to a kind of preparation method of the short fiber reinforced silicon carbide ceramics containing silicon-dioxide, belong to technical field of ceramic production.
Background technology
Silicon carbide ceramics obtains applying more and more widely because it has excellent hot strength, wear-corrosion resistance and heat-shock resistance.Silicon carbide ceramics plays more and more important effect at Material Field.Therefore, in the urgent need to further studying in carbofrax material, so that while improving constantly its premium properties, reducing production cost, simplifying production technique, promote the production of silicon carbide ceramics product.Carborundum refractory has that hot strength is high, thermal conductivity good, good corrosion resistance etc. feature, very extensive in industrial aspect purposes such as potteries.Owing to being subject to the restriction of preparation and fabrication technology, the development of ceramic fast-firing technique cannot be broken through, and the pottery of traditional clayey, High-Alumina and clay-carborundum cannot meet market demands.The silicon-dioxide that the present invention adds not only increases the thermostability of silicon carbide ceramics, also there is high intensity, preferably erosion resistance, high thermal conductivity etc., introduce the mechanical property that chopped carbon fiber improves silicon carbide, improve the fracture toughness property of material, improve intensity and the density of biscuit, suppress the generation of various defect in biscuit preparation, meeting machining needs, is a kind of comparatively ideal refractory materials.
Summary of the invention
The object of this invention is to provide a kind of preparation method of the short fiber reinforced silicon carbide ceramics containing silicon-dioxide.
In order to realize object of the present invention, the present invention is by following scheme implementation:
A preparation method for short fiber reinforced silicon carbide ceramics containing silicon-dioxide, is made up of the raw material of following weight part: silicon carbide 60-80, chopped carbon fiber predispersion 10-15, sintering aid 3-4, abrasive silica 8-12, iridium black 2-3, albite in powder 4-6, mullite powder 4-6, dehydrated alcohol 20-25, POLYPROPYLENE GLYCOL 2-3, deionized water 70-80;
Described sintering aid becomes 200-300 order powder by the zirconium boride 99.5004323A8ure of the aluminum oxide of 10-15 weight part, 8-12 weight part, the carbon dust mixed grinding of 15-20 weight part, add the methylene-bisacrylamide of 0.4-0.8 weight part and the ethanolic soln mixing and stirring of 10-15 weight part, heating boils off solvent and be pressed into stock under 10-15MPa, then under 600-800 ° of C, is dried and crushed into 150-200 order powder.
The preparation method of chopped carbon fiber predispersion of the present invention is: be cut to length at 1-3mm by short for carbon fiber, low-temperature oxidation 1-2 hour under 500-600 ° of C, being immersed volume ratio is again in the dust technology of 3:7 and the mixing solutions of acetone, soak after 1-2 days and repeatedly rinse surface with deionized water until solution is in neutral, sol-gel method is adopted to form zirconia coating at carbon fiber surface after drying, again this carbon fiber is immersed in the water completely, ultrasonic wave dispersion 10-20 minute, add the OP-10 emulsifying agent of carbon fiber 0.3-0.5 times weight part again, continue ultrasonic disperse 1-2 hour.
The preparation method of a kind of short fiber reinforced silicon carbide ceramics containing silicon-dioxide of the present invention, is made up of following concrete steps:
(1) mixing of silicon carbide, abrasive silica, iridium black and deionized water is added in ball grinder, with high-purity alpha-alumina abrading-ball ball milling 2-3 hour, add all the other remaining compositions except chopped carbon fiber predispersion again and carry out wet-mixed with the rotating speed of 300-400 rev/min, mixing 1-2 hour;
(2) chopped carbon fiber predispersion is added in step (1), rotating speed is reduced to 100-200 rev/min, continue ball milling 1-2 hour, the slurry mixed at room temperature is bled and is slowly added in metal die, then be placed in insulation can under 80 ° of C, be incubated 30-50 minute after the demoulding, at room temperature seasoning no longer reduces to weight;
(3) inserted in reaction sintering stove by the ceramics biscuits of carbonized bricks that step (2) obtains, vacuumized by sintering oven, be warming up to 1600-1700 ° of C with 20-25 ° of C/min, constant temperature keeps 3-5 hour, and sample furnace cooling can obtain.
Advantage of the present invention is: the chopped carbon fiber that the present invention adds improves the mechanical property of silicon carbide, improve the fracture toughness property of pottery, improve intensity and the density of biscuit, meet machining needs, the silicon-dioxide added enhances the effects such as the thermostability of silicon carbide ceramics, intensity, erosion resistance and thermal conductivity, and raw material sources of the present invention are convenient, easy to operate, cost is low, application prospect is good.
specific embodiments
Below by specific examples, the present invention is described in detail.
A preparation method for short fiber reinforced silicon carbide ceramics containing silicon-dioxide, is made up of the raw material of following weight part (kilogram): silicon carbide 75, chopped carbon fiber predispersion 10, sintering aid 3, abrasive silica 12, iridium black 3, albite in powder 6, mullite powder 4, dehydrated alcohol 20, POLYPROPYLENE GLYCOL 3, deionized water 80;
Described sintering aid becomes 300 order powder by the zirconium boride 99.5004323A8ure of the aluminum oxide of 15 weight parts, 8 weight parts, the carbon dust mixed grinding of 18 weight parts, add the methylene-bisacrylamide of 0.6 weight part and the ethanolic soln mixing and stirring of 15 weight parts, heating boils off solvent and be pressed into stock under 12MPa, then under 700 ° of C, is dried and crushed into 200 order powder.
The preparation method of chopped carbon fiber predispersion of the present invention is: be cut to length at 3mm by short for carbon fiber, low-temperature oxidation 2 hours under 600 ° of C, being immersed volume ratio is again in the dust technology of 3:7 and the mixing solutions of acetone, soak after 1 day and repeatedly rinse surface with deionized water until solution is in neutral, sol-gel method is adopted to form zirconia coating at carbon fiber surface after drying, again this carbon fiber is immersed in the water completely, ultrasonic wave disperses 20 minutes, add the OP-10 emulsifying agent of carbon fiber 0.5 times of weight part again, continue ultrasonic disperse 2 hours.
The preparation method of a kind of short fiber reinforced silicon carbide ceramics containing silicon-dioxide of the present invention, is made up of following concrete steps:
(1) mixing of silicon carbide, abrasive silica, iridium black and deionized water is added in ball grinder, with high-purity alpha-alumina abrading-ball ball milling 3 hours, add all the other remaining compositions except chopped carbon fiber predispersion again and carry out wet-mixed with the rotating speed of 400 revs/min, mix 1 hour;
(2) chopped carbon fiber predispersion is added in step (1), rotating speed is reduced to 200 revs/min, continue ball milling 2 hours, the slurry mixed at room temperature is bled and is slowly added in metal die, then be placed in insulation can under 80 ° of C, be incubated 50 minutes after the demoulding, at room temperature seasoning no longer reduces to weight;
(3) inserted in reaction sintering stove by the ceramics biscuits of carbonized bricks that step (2) obtains, vacuumized by sintering oven, be warming up to 1700 ° of C with 20 ° of C/min, constant temperature keeps 4 hours, and sample furnace cooling can obtain.
In the present embodiment, the performance index result of pottery is as follows:
Hardness (GPa): 43.2;
Young's modulus (GPa): 410;
Folding strength (MPa): 230;
Fracture toughness property (Mpa/m 1/2): 4.22;
Thermal expansivity (10 -5/ K): 1.8;
Thermal conductivity (W/mK): 100.
